HOUSTON — The Artemis II crew achieved a historic milestone Wednesday as the Orion spacecraft completed its closest approach to the lunar surface, swinging around the far side of the Moon in a free-return trajectory that marks humanity's deepest crewed journey beyond low-Earth orbit since Apollo 17 in 1972. NASA's Johnson Space Center confirmed telemetry lock was re-established after the planned communications blackout during the lunar far-side pass, with all four crew members reported in good health.

Commander Reid Wiseman and his crewmates used the Orion spacecraft's optical navigation camera system and handheld DSLR equipment to capture high-resolution imagery of the lunar far side — terrain no human eye has observed at close range in over five decades. NASA's Mission Control in Houston confirmed the image packages were downlinked successfully within hours of the spacecraft re-emerging from behind the Moon, with the agency planning a public release of select frames later Wednesday.

The flyby distance set a new record for crewed spaceflight distance from Earth, surpassing the Apollo 13 mark that the crew had already eclipsed earlier in the mission. Flight directors at Johnson Space Center described the far-side pass as nominal, with Orion's main propulsion system performing within expected parameters during the critical engine burn that shaped the return trajectory toward a Pacific Ocean splashdown.

Scientific teams at the Lunar Reconnaissance Orbiter operations center at NASA Goddard were cross-referencing Artemis II imagery against existing orbital maps, hoping the oblique angles captured by the crew would reveal new detail about shadowed crater regions near the lunar south pole — terrain identified as a priority landing zone for Artemis III. Geologists expressed particular interest in images of the South Pole–Aitken Basin, one of the solar system's largest known impact craters.

Public and media attention to the mission surged Wednesday as real-time tracking tools showed Orion beginning its homeward arc. NASA's live stream of the crew's video call from lunar distance drew millions of concurrent viewers globally, and agency officials said the communications and life-support systems had performed without anomaly throughout the mission's most demanding phase. Splashdown remains scheduled for later this week off the coast of San Diego, where the USS San Diego recovery vessel is already on station.
